3-Benzofuranmethanamine, N-methyl-

Base Information
  • Chemical Name:3-Benzofuranmethanamine, N-methyl-
  • CAS No.:78629-16-0
  • Molecular Formula:C10H11 N O
  • Molecular Weight:161.203
  • Hs Code.:2932999099

Technology Process of 3-Benzofuranmethanamine, N-methyl-

There total 1 articles about 3-Benzofuranmethanamine, N-methyl- which guide to synthetic route it. synthetic route:
Guidance literature:
1-benzofuran-3-carbaldehyde; methylamine; In methanol; at 20 ℃; for 4h;
With sodium tetrahydroborate; In methanol; at 0 ℃; for 0.166667h;
